ØMQ
Development
ØMQ (also known as ZeroMQ) is an open-source messaging library that provides a flexible lightweight abstraction for distributed and concurrent applications. It offers a socket API for building fast and efficient asynchronous message-based applications.

Polyglot Club
Education & Reference
Polyglot Club is an online platform for learning foreign languages. It connects you with native speakers around the world to practice conversing in different languages. Features include lesson plans, flashcards, grammar guides, and community forums.
